CodeWhisperer

Amazon CodeWhisperer

Il tuo strumento di produttività basato sull'intelligenza artificiale per l'IDE e la linea di comando

Inizia subito con il livello Individual:

- Gratuito per l'uso individuale
- Suggerimenti di codice illimitati
- Monitoraggio dei riferimenti
- Cinquanta scansioni di sicurezza (per utente, al mese)

Ulteriori informazioni »

Più risultati, più rapidamente

Amazon CodeWhisperer genera suggerimenti di codice che vanno da frammenti a funzioni complete in tempo reale nell'IDE sulla base dei commenti e del codice esistente. Supporta anche i completamenti della CLI e la traduzione da linguaggio naturale a bash nella linea di comando.

Potenzia lo sviluppo con l'assistente esperto Amazon Q

Amazon Q è un assistente interattivo basato sull'IA generativa disponibile nell'IDE tramite CodeWhisperer che offre una guida esperta attraverso una semplice interfaccia conversazionale. Usa Amazon Q nell'IDE per:

  • Spiegare il tuo codice: avvia una conversazione con Amazon Q per comprendere il codice del tuo progetto, il tutto attraverso un dialogo naturale.
  • Trasformare il tuo codice: aggiorna e migra la tua applicazione alla versione linguistica più recente in pochi minuti.
  • Ottenere suggerimenti personalizzati sul codice: Ask e Amazon Q possono fornire suggerimenti per aggiungere test unitari, eseguire il debug, ottimizzare il codice e altro ancora.

Ulteriori informazioni »

Creazione di codice sicura

CodeWhisperer può contrassegnare o filtrare suggerimenti di codice che assomigliano a codice disponibile pubblicamente. Ottieni l'URL e la licenza del repository del progetto open source associato in modo da poterli esaminare più facilmente e aggiungere l'attribuzione.

Rafforzamento della sicurezza del codice

Scansiona il codice per identificare le vulnerabilità di sicurezza difficili da trovare e ottieni suggerimenti sul codice per risolvere i problemi identificati. I suggerimenti di codice basati sull'IA generativa sono personalizzati in base al codice della tua applicazione, così puoi accettare rapidamente le correzioni con sicurezza e concentrarti su lavori a più alto valore.

Possibilità di utilizzare gli strumenti preferiti

CodeWhisperer si adatta al tuo modo di lavorare. Scegli tra 15 linguaggi di programmazione, tra cui Python, Java e JavaScript, e gli ambienti di sviluppo integrati (IDE) che preferisci, tra cui VS Code, IntelliJ IDEA, Visual Studio (anteprima), AWS Cloud9, la console AWS Lambda, JupyterLab ed Amazon SageMaker Studio, e la tua linea di comando tra cui il terminale macOS, iTerm2 e il terminale integrato VS Code.

* In questo esempio, dopo aver creato una personalizzazione privata, gli sviluppatori di 'AnyCompany' ricevono consigli sul codice CodeWhisperer che includono le API e le librerie interne.

Personalizza CodeWhisperer per suggerimenti ancora migliori

Puoi personalizzare CodeWhisperer per generare consigli più pertinenti rendendolo consapevole delle tue librerie interne, API, pacchetti, classi e metodi, accelerando in modo significativo lo sviluppo.

Ulteriori informazioni »

Un enorme balzo in avanti nella produttività degli sviluppatori

Il 57% più rapidamente

Il 27% di probabilità di successo in più

Durante l'anteprima, Amazon ha lanciato una sfida di produttività e i partecipanti che hanno utilizzato CodeWhisperer hanno avuto il 27% di probabilità in più di completare le attività con successo e lo hanno fatto con una media del 57% di velocità in più rispetto a chi non utilizzava CodeWhisperer.

Esplora il servizio
Scopri come CodeWhisperer può accelerare e migliorare lo sviluppo del tuo software con la generazione di codice, il monitoraggio dei riferimenti e le scansioni di sicurezza.
Scopri come Accenture utilizza CodeWhisperer
Accenture utilizza CodeWhisperer per migliorare la produttività degli sviluppatori, ad esempio per l'onboarding degli sviluppatori, la scrittura di codice boilerplate, l'utilizzo di linguaggi sconosciuti e il rilevamento di vulnerabilità relative alla sicurezza.
Crea un'app
Crea un'app serverless basata su eventi in Python in meno di 10 minuti, utilizzando Amazon SQS, Amazon Simple Storage Service (Amazon S3), Amazon DynamoDB e altro ancora.

Inizia a creare con CodeWhisperer